이 글에 구현된 기능: 주제 제목과 주제 내용을 동시에 표시합니다. 프로젝트 구현 결과를 직접 보고 싶다면 제목 아래에서 문제를 해결하는 내용을 직접 볼 수 있습니다
원본 모바일 페이지 레이아웃입니다
이것이 달성되어야 하는 효과입니다
원본 `uploadtemplatedefaulttouchforumviewthread.htm`
에서 볼 수 있습니다 제목과 내용이 따로 표시되고 최종적으로 사용된다는 것 아니면 `$_G[forum_thread][subject]`
이 변수`uploadtemplatedefaulttouchforumviewthread.htm`
这个文件中我们可以看到标题跟内容是分开显示的,最终用的还是`$_G[forum_thread][subject]`
这个变量
这个时候就有一个问题,那就是我们的主题内容怎么取出来呢!先看源码的内容变量是什么
来到`uploadtemplatedefaulttouchforumviewthread.htm`
的163行,我们可以看到是用`$post[message]`
이번에 질문이 있습니다. 즉, 테마 컨텐츠를 어떻게 내보내는지 입니다! 먼저 소스코드의 콘텐츠 변수가 무엇인지 살펴보겠습니다.
`uploadtemplatedefaulttouchforumviewthread.htm`
의 163번째 줄을 보면 `$post[message]`라는 변수를 볼 수 있습니다. code>가 사용됨 구현됨
무슨 일이 있어도 이 태그를 먼저 사용해본 후 이야기해 보세요
파일의 마지막 줄이 우리가 마지막으로 mod 변수를 인쇄하여 What
인지 확인하면 됩니다. 위 그림에 따르면 `upload/source/module/forum/forum_viewthread.php` 파일을 직접 입력하면 확인할 수 있습니다. 이 두 변수는 매우 친숙한가요? 이 두 변수가 우리 템플릿에 사용되는 것 아닌가요?
이 두 변수를 출력해 봅시다
Discus 열기 데이터베이스 사전 `pre_forum_post` 테이블이 바로 우리에게 필요한 것입니다
로컬 데이터베이스를 열면 이것이 우리에게 필요한 데이터가 아니라는 것을 알게 될 것입니다.
말할 것도 별로 없고, 주소창에 있는 매개변수만 출력하세요
tid에 따라 직접 쿼리하고, 메시지 필드를 넣으면 시간이 딱 필요해요! 상황에 따라 결정하세요
그런 다음 템플릿에서 호출합니다
위 내용은 【Discuz】주제 제목과 텍스트가 동시에 표시되도록 실현의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!